Why Edge Of Tomorrow 2 Should Happen
The First Film Leaves Enough Room For A Follow-Up

The first Edge of Tomorrow film has a conclusive ending where Tom Cruise’s Major William Cage saves the day by destroying the Omega and reuniting with Vrataski. Vrataski seems oblivious to his identity because Cruise’s character gets time-looped back to the base operation after completing his mission. However, the closing arc still seems conclusive enough to give audiences closure despite having some logical inconsistencies. While this makes it hard not to wonder what a sequel could be about, the first movie’s alien lore and time-loop trope leave enough room for many new ideas.

Doug Liman once revealed (via Collider) that “Edge of Tomorrow 2 is a sequel that’s a prequel,” which could mean that the film could explore Vrataski’s efforts to end the war as a looper before she met Cage. Using forward-jumping time loops as a narrative device, the sequel could connect Vrataski’s backstory to the first film’s events, adding new layers of time-traveling madness to the franchise’s narrative. Since the first Edge of Tomorrow movie was based on Hiroshi Sakurazaka’s book, All You Need Is Kill, the second movie would adopt an original storyline, making it even more exciting and novel.
With the opportunity to explore many narrative avenues with its time-loop trope, Edge of Tomorrow 2 could be as successful as the first film (if not more). It could even mark the inception of a new action franchise for Tom Cruise after Mission: Impossible. Will Edge Of Tomorrow 2 Ever Actually Happen?
Its Future Remains Uncertain


Although Edge of Tomorrow 2‘s production was initially gaining some momentum and Doug Liman had also prepared its script, the film has sadly remained in development hell for years. Emily Blunt read its script and teased that it had great ideas, which promised Edge of Tomorrow 2 could be a worthy sequel that builds upon its predecessor’s success. Doug Liman, too, recently gave some positive updates surrounding Edge of Tomorrow 2 by revealing how Warner Bros. is “constantly” asking him if he plans to revisit the franchise.

However, given how Liman is busy with several other upcoming projects and will also helm the sequel to Amazon’s widely successful Road House remake, it seems uncertain when he will have time to revisit the Edge of Tomorrow franchise. Tom Cruise and Emily Blunt are also a part of several upcoming big-budget projects, which could lead to scheduling issues for the movie’s filming. Hopefully, Edge of Tomorrow 2‘s production will take off soon and eventually pave the way for a full-fledged sci-fi franchise.
